1 change: 1 addition & 0 deletions NEWS.md
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-47,6 +47,7 @@
* `fixed_regex_linter()` recognizes usage of the new (R 4.5.0) `grepv()` wrapper of `grep()`; `regex_subset_linter()` also recommends `grepv()` alternatives (#2855, @MichaelChirico).
* `object_usage_linter()` lints missing packages that may cause false positives (#2872, @AshesITR)
* New argument `include_s4_slots` for the `xml_find_function_calls()` entry in the `get_source_expressions()` to govern whether calls of the form `s4Obj@fun()` are included in the result (#2820, @MichaelChirico).
* `sprintf_linter()` lints `sprintf()` and `gettextf()` calls when a constant string is passed to `fmt` (#2894, @Bisaloo).
